WebMar 20, 2024 · 4. Require all new directors to read, understand, and pledge to operate according to church bylaws. Make them accessible by keeping a board notebook with all essential documents, including articles, bylaws, resolutions, statements of faith and meeting minutes from the last two years (at least). 5. Review your bylaws regularly. WebIn Pastor Ryan’s case, the church’s bylaws stated that a pastor could be removed by a majority vote of the board of directors. WebBylaws are your organization's operating manual. They define: Rules and procedures for holding meetings, electing directors, and appointing officers. State nonprofit laws usually address nonprofit governance matters. However, you can choose different rules, as long as they don't violate state law and are included in your bylaws.
